Wabi-Sabi Expressions

 

Embrace the art of imperfection with Wabi-Sabi Expressions, a moodboard that celebrates Wabi-Sabi interior design — the Japanese philosophy of beauty found in simplicity, authenticity, and time-worn detail. This collection reflects a calm, grounded aesthetic where natural materials, handcrafted furniture, and organic shapes define a sense of effortless harmony.

 

Rich textures of raw wood, handmade ceramics, and woven natural fibers meet a soothing earthy color palette of clay, sand, and stone. Each surface tells its own quiet story — from the patina of aged timber to the uneven glaze of a pottery vase. Together, these elements create a space that feels calm, tactile, and deeply human.

 

Drawing inspiration from Japandi decor and organic modern living, Wabi-Sabi Expressions encourages you to slow down, to curate interiors that value craftsmanship over perfection, and emotion over excess. It’s about creating balance between emptiness and form, shadow and light, stillness and movement.
